David Beckham digitally aged into his 70s for Malaria No More video campaign – 7NEWS.com.au
The former England football star has spoken out with a sobering message.

David Beckham is perhaps as famed for his looks as he is for his football career — but a new campaign is showing him as youve never seen him before.
The 45-year-old former Manchester United and Real Madrid midfielder has been given a digital makeover which imagines what Beckham might look like in his 70s.
It is part of a campaign from the British arm of US nonprofit Malaria No More, which says there is an agreement among scientists that malaria can be defeated within our lifetime.
